Top 5 3D Realistic Games on Android in Netherlands: Q1 2025
Explore the performance trends of the leading 3D realistic games on Android in the Netherlands during the first quarter of 2025, featuring insights on downloads, revenue, and active users.
In the first quarter of 2025, the Android gaming landscape in the Netherlands saw significant activity among the top 3D realistic games. Here's a detailed look at the performance of these leading apps, with data sourced from Sensor Tower.
PUBG MOBILE from Level Infinite experienced robust weekly revenue growth, culminating at around $27K by the end of March. Weekly downloads peaked at 5.9K in mid-March, while active users fluctuated, peaking over 55K before settling at approximately 49K.
ReelShort - Stream Drama & TV showed a varied performance. Revenue hit a high of about $22K in early March, with downloads notably spiking to 14.7K in the same period. Active users increased significantly, reaching nearly 20K in mid-March before tapering off.
State of Survival: Zombie War by FunPlus International AG maintained a steady revenue stream, peaking at about $20K in late January. Downloads were modest, peaking at 586, while active users hovered around 4K, with slight declines observed as the quarter progressed.
Call of Duty: Mobile Season 3 from Activision Publishing, Inc. saw revenue fluctuations, reaching a high of $24K in late January. Downloads remained relatively stable, peaking at 1.4K, while active users consistently stayed above 24K, showing resilience through the quarter.
EA SPORTS FC™ Mobile Soccer from ELECTRONIC ARTS experienced a decline in revenue, starting at $12K and decreasing towards the end of the quarter. Downloads were consistent, peaking at 4.6K, while active users showed stability, maintaining over 113K through most of the quarter.
